説明可能な機械学習モデルによる原因不明の塞栓性脳卒中における原因プラーク石灰化の分類

まとめ
機械学習モデルは、原因不明の塞栓性脳卒中(ESUS)における原因となる頸動脈プラークを従来のモデルよりも効果的に特定できます。説明可能なAI(SHAP)は、脳卒中リスク評価の改善に重要なプラークの特徴を明らかにします。

背景:
- 原因不明の塞栓性脳卒中(ESUS)は、50%未満の狭窄であっても頸動脈プラークと関連している。
- プラークの脆弱性は、プラーク内出血(IPH)、脂質リッチ壊死コア、血管周囲脂肪組織(PVAT)、および石灰化の影響を受ける。
- 従来のプラーク評価は、特に機械学習(ML)モデルの場合、解釈可能性が欠けている。
研究 の 目的:
- 原因プラークと非原因プラークを分類するために、SHapley Additive exPlanations(SHAP)を用いた説明可能なMLアプローチを適用する。
- 脳卒中の原因となる可能性のあるプラークおよび石灰化の特徴を特定する。
- 脳卒中予測におけるMLモデルの臨床的解釈性を高める。
主な方法:
- CT血管造影で石灰化頸動脈プラークを有する片側前循環ESUS患者の後ろ向き解析。
- PVAT量を含む石灰化レベルおよびプラークレベルの特徴の抽出。
- 8つのML分類器のベンチマーキング、勾配ブースト決定木(CatBoost)をSHAPを用いて調整および説明。
主要な成果:
- 5つのプラーク/石灰化特徴を用いたMLモデルは、ROC-AUC 0.79を達成し、プラーク厚(0.59)およびIPHの存在(0.51)を上回った。
- SHAP分析により、プラーク厚(>2.6 mm)およびPVAT量(≥112 mm³)が最も影響力のある特徴として特定された。
- モデルは、原因となる石灰化頸動脈プラークの優れた分類精度を示した。
結論:
- 非石灰化プラークおよび石灰化特徴を組み込んだMLモデルは、ESUSにおける原因となる頸動脈プラークの分類を改善する。
- 説明可能なML(SHAP)は、臨床的に解釈可能な洞察を提供し、プラークの脆弱性に関連する可能性のある閾値を示唆する。
- このアプローチは、塞栓性脳卒中に関連するプラークの特徴の理解を深める。
